Arthur Theodore Schultz

Arthur Theodore Schultz, age 90, formerly of Rock Creek and more recently of Pine City, Minn., died Monday, Jan. 3, 2005 at the Lakeside Nursing Home in Pine City.

He was born Feb. 9, 1914 in St. Paul, Minnesota and was the son of Theodore and Ida (Luhrsen) Schultz. At the age of one year, he moved with his family to Heidelberg, Minn. When Art was six years old, the Schultz family purchased a farm in St. Paul in the area that is now Roseville, Minnesota.

In 1933, Art graduated from high school at the School of Agriculture, University of Minnesota, St. Paul Campus. He then enrolled in the University of Minnesota School of Agriculture and studied agronomy and botany. Following graduation in 1939, Art worked on the family farm for a time before becoming employed with the United States Department of Agriculture. Later he worked at the Minnesota Highway Department.

Art married the former Gladys Erickson from Starkweather, North Dakota in 1943.

In 1947, Art began teaching agriculture courses to veterans at Foley, Minnesota. During his teaching career there he also served five years as a scoutmaster in the scouting program sponsored by the Gustavus Adolphus Church.

Art and Gladys purchased a farm in Rock Creek in 1954. Art raised broiler chickens and in 1958 he purchased the feed mill in Rock Creek. Besides operating the feed mill, Art also raised hogs until the time of his retirement in 1975.

Instrumental in starting the Soil Conservation District in 1958, Art remained active in soil conservation for a period of 40 years. He further served his community as a 4-H leader for 24 years, and was actively involved in incorporating the Township of Rock Creek as a city in 1970. He was an active member of the Gideons, Farm Bureau, and Senior Singers, and until suffering a stroke in 2000, he was active in his church and a Bible study at Lakeside. As an author, he wrote a book on the history of Rock Creek and his autobiography for his children and grandchildren.
